The direct-answer block, explained
The 40–60 word paragraph at the top of every page does more work than the rest of the page combined.

A direct-answer block is a 40 to 60 word paragraph at the top of a page that fully answers the page's title question. AI engines lift it verbatim into citations.

The template
Open the page with a single paragraph between 40 and 60 words. Begin with the brand name, the page topic, or the page's title-question subject. Use plain language, one specific number when honest, and end with the single most important fact for the buyer.
Do not use marketing copy. Do not bury the answer in a hero animation. Do not split the answer across two paragraphs. The block is one paragraph for one reason: an LLM lifts paragraphs, not multi-paragraph compositions.
Three rewrites we did this month
Plumbing client, services page. Before: 80 words of brand storytelling. After: 'ABC Plumbing handles residential plumbing, drain cleaning, and water-heater repair in Salt Lake City and Davis County. Most service calls are completed in one visit, with transparent flat-rate pricing posted on the truck before any work starts. Licensed in Utah since 2013, with a 4.9 average rating across 312 verified reviews.' Bookings up 11% month-over-month.
Roofing client, location page. Before: a video and a hero CTA. After: a 52-word direct-answer block above the video. Time-on-page up 19%; AI citation appearances tracked in our weekly prompt-test grid up from 0 to 4 in 6 weeks.
Med-spa client, pricing page. Before: a price-list table only. After: a 47-word direct answer above the table summarizing the three most-booked services and their starting prices. Page now appears as a Perplexity citation for 'med spa pricing salt lake city' — a query type that price-table pages rarely earn.
Why it works
An LLM building a citation-eligible answer needs a passage it can quote without distortion. The shorter and more self-contained the passage, the higher the lift probability. The direct-answer block is engineered to be the passage with the highest lift probability on the page.
